Manila, Philippines - After an intimate gig and pre-Christmas celebration at its first stop, SUYEN continues her Katabi Tour with its second show, returning closer to home as the tour stops at Imajin, Marikina—SUYEN’s hometown—on February 21, 2026.
Following her collaboration with veteran rock band Sandwich on “Basura”, SUYEN returns with “Katabi” — revealing a more vulnerable yet romantic side that captures her continued growth as one of the most exciting emerging voices in Philippine music.
Joining the lineup are Kenaniah, Jamiela, Frank Ely, and shirebound, each bringing their distinct sound and storytelling to a night anchored in shared emotion and the quiet but tender yearning of being close to one another that defines SUYEN’s Katabi.

The show will also be Kailan Saan’s first event of the year. Launched in early 2025, Kailan Saan is a collective founded by Arts Management graduate students from the De La Salle College of Saint Benilde, dedicated to creating spaces that connect artists and audiences through innovative and curatorial approaches. Since their launch, the collectives have organized several notable events, including Kenaniah’s Music Video Launch in partnership with OC Records and SUYEN’s EP Launch in 2025
